Tyreek Hill Hypes Rashee Rice, Chiefs After WR's Return in Win, 'Love to See It'

After more than a year off the field, Kansas City Chiefs wide receiver Rashee Rice returned to action on Sunday.

After the game, Miami Dolphins wide receiver Tyreek Hill hyped Rice’s performance and praised his former team on social media.

“Also Rashee Rice is so dangerous !! Chiefs back rolling love to see it,” Hill wrote.

Hill suffered a season-ending torn ACL last month, so he is unfortunately limited to watching games rather than playing them. Rice surely appreciates getting some love from one of the best wide receivers of the last decade.

Rice put together a solid performance in his first game back, logging seven receptions for 42 yards and a pair of touchdowns as the Chiefs beat the Las Vegas Raiders 31-0.

Rice suffered a season-ending knee injury after just four games in 2024. He was then suspended for the first six games of the 2025 campaign for violating the NFL’s personal conduct policy.

Now, he’s back on the field and is looking to get his career back on track. Sunday’s performance was a good start.
